Q: Is 17,365,471 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 17,365,471 is a composite number.

Why is 17,365,471 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 17,365,471 can be evenly divided by 1 3,853 4,507 and 17,365,471, with no remainder.

Since 17,365,471 cannot be divided by just 1 and 17,365,471, it is a composite number.
